CICUTTINI, FARHAT NAMED OCAA BASKETBALL ATHLETES OF THE WEEK

TORONTO - The following have been named Ontario Colleges Athletic Association (OCAA) basketball student-athletes of the week for the period ending Sunday, March 18.

MALE: Andrew Cicuttini, Mohawk

Second-year forward Andrew Cicuttini (Dundas, Ont.) was named tournament most valuable player at the recent Canadian Collegiate Athletic Association (CCAA) Men's Basketball National Championship in Truro, N.S. Cicuttini contributed a pair of double-doubles, and averaged 21 points and 13 rebounds in three games, well above his regular season average of 10.2 points and 8.4 rebounds. Cicuttini's contributions helped the Mountaineers win their first national title.

FEMALE: Abeer Farhat, Algonquin

First-year guard Abeer Farhat (Ottawa) was named a tournament second-team all-star at the recent CCAA Women's Basketball National Championship in Lethbridge, Alta. Farhat averaged 28.5 points in three games. She was named Algonquin's player of the game in its 74-62 quarter-final victory over the UNBC Timberwolves after scoring 23 points while adding eight assists. Farhat is a member of the OCAA East region second-team all-stars as well as a member of its all-rookie team.
